Do You Remember Heidi?
“Heidi” tells the story of a young orphaned girl named Heidi who is sent to live with her gruff grandfather in the Swiss Alps. Over time, Heidi brings joy to her grandfather's life and forms a close bond with him and a young boy called Peter who takes care of the goats. However, her aunt takes her to Frankfurt to become a companion to a sickly girl named Clara. Eventually, Heidi returns to her grandfather and the mountains, where she finds happiness and a sense of belonging. The novel emphasizes themes of family, friendship, and the beauty of nature.
Bündner Herrschaft
The wine region near Heidi Village in Maienfeld is known as the "Bündner Herrschaft." This area is famous for its vineyards and wine production, benefiting from its unique microclimate and favorable conditions for grape cultivation.
